Renowned chef Gordon Ramsey, known for his fiery television presence, recently took a moment to step back from his bold persona to share a deeply personal experience: the loss of his unborn child. Alongside his wife, Tana, Ramsey revealed their heartbreaking miscarriage in a heartfelt Facebook post.
In his message, the 49-year-old father of four expressed the sorrow they felt, stating, “Tana has sadly miscarried our son at five months. We’re together healing as a family, but we want to thank everyone again for all your amazing support and well wishes.” He shared a touching photo of the couple from a triathlon they participated in last summer and extended his gratitude to the compassionate staff at Portland Hospital.
The post struck a chord with many followers, earning over 41,000 likes and nearly 6,000 comments from individuals who have faced similar grief. While Ramsey and Tana are not the first to publicly address their miscarriage, their openness about such a painful topic is immensely impactful. According to the American Pregnancy Association, miscarriage occurs in 10 to 25 percent of all clinically recognized pregnancies, yet the conversation surrounding it remains limited.
By sharing their story, the Ramsays created a space for healing and connection among those who have experienced similar losses. Their courage in opening up about their pain has sparked a much-needed dialogue, reminding many that they are not alone.
